Industrial Control Systems: Siemens, Allen-Bradley, ABB, Schneider – Key Features and Applications
Process Systems – Siemens, Allen-Bradley, ABB, Schneider – offer key approaches within the realm of production control. Siemens, established for its SIMATIC PLC portfolio and SCADA software, excels in advanced systems, such for power distribution, oil & gas processing, and large-scale automotive manufacturing. Allen-Bradley – part of Rockwell Automation – is generally known for its dependable controller components and Logix platform, finding broad application in intermittent manufacturing, robotics, and material transfer. ABB, a global player, provides integrated offerings encompassing PLCs, HMIs, drives, and robotics, frequently applied in sectors like chemicals, food & beverage, and pulp & paper. Finally, Schneider Electric supplies a comprehensive selection of power control and automation solutions, including Modicon PLCs and EcoStruxure platform, servicing buildings, infrastructure, and industrial processes.

The Evolution of Automation: A Look at Siemens, Allen-Bradley, ABB, and Schneider Technologies
This development of industrial control represents the remarkable change driven by progress from key companies like Siemens, Allen-Bradley (now Rockwell Automation), ABB, and Schneider Electric. Early on, these organizations concentrated on separate device control using relay logic and pneumatic devices. Yet, an introduction of programmable logic devices (PLCs) marked an critical stage. Siemens’ SIMATIC, Allen-Bradley’s 5000 series, ABB’s Freelance, and Schneider Electric’s Modicon demonstrated increased adaptability and efficiency. Later, a increase of networked regulation platforms, incorporating fieldbuses like Profibus, DeviceNet, and Modbus, allowed expanded complex production processes. Now, these firms are leading an charge towards digital integration, with technologies like remote computing, a Industrial Internet of IIoT (IIoT), and next-generation data protocols.
